Latest Patents

Basker's latest patents showcase his expertise and address critical challenges in semiconductor technology. The first patent, titled "Methods for Fabricating Silicon Carriers with Conductive Through-Vias with Low Stress and Low Defect Density," provides innovative methods for high-yield manufacturing of silicon carriers. This invention allows for the creation of conductive through-vias with diameters of 1 to 10 microns and a vertical thickness ranging from less than 10 micrometers to more than 300 micrometers. The methods emphasize robustness against thermal-mechanical stresses, minimizing thermal mechanical movement at the interface of silicon, insulators, liners, and conductor materials.

The second patent, "Selective Silicide Formation by Electrodeposit Displacement Reaction," introduces a novel approach for silicide formation processes. This method utilizes an electrochemical displacement reaction without applying an external current or potential. In this process, metallic materials are deposited on selected areas of semiconductor topography, enabling efficient silicide formation during the annealing process.
